BIOGRAPHY

Cleo Moore, a vivacious blonde bombshell of 1950s cinema, carved out a niche as an alluring, often tragic, femme fatale, making her a compelling subject for film collectors. While she frequently appeared as a secondary lead in B-movies, her distinctive presence and striking looks ensured she commanded attention. Collectors often seek out her earlier work like *711 Ocean Drive* (1950) and her uncredited but memorable role in Nicholas Ray's noir classic *On Dangerous Ground* (1951), both for their historical significance and the early glimpses of her evolving screen persona. Moore became particularly renowned for her collaborations with director Hugo Haas, a seven-film partnership that became a hallmark of her career. Titles such as *One Girl's Confession* (1953) and *Bait* (1954) epitomize this period, offering sensationalistic storylines that are a perfect fit for vintage grindhouse-style collections. Her later films, including the crime drama *Over-Exposed* (1956) and the raw *Hit and Run* (1957), continue to be sought after, often experiencing limited physical media releases. For collectors, owning Cleo Moore's filmography means delving into the fascinating, sometimes forgotten, corners of 1950s Hollywood, where her bold performances continue to captivate.

What is Cleo Moore known for?

Cleo Moore is known for her acting, particularly in films such as Over-Exposed (1956) as Lily Krenshka / Lila Crane, Bait (1954) as Peggy, and One Girl's Confession (1953) as Mary Adams.

What genres does Cleo Moore's filmography span?

Cleo Moore's filmography spans genres including Crime, Drama, Action, Western, Mystery, and Adventure.

What era or decades does Cleo Moore's work cover?

Cleo Moore's work spans from 1948 to 1957, with her most-active decade being the 1950s.

What is the range and breadth of Cleo Moore's work?

Cleo Moore has appeared in a total of 19 films throughout her career.

What are some notable films in Cleo Moore's filmography?

Some notable films in Cleo Moore's filmography include Thy Neighbor's Wife (1953) as Lita Vojnar, 711 Ocean Drive (1950) as Mal's Date (uncredited), and Hunt the Man Down (1950) as Pat Sheldon.
